Voice, Agency and Resistance: Emancipatory Discourses in Action
Voice, Agency and Resistance: Emancipatory Discourses in Action
Drawing on data from Africa, Latin America, North America, and Arab Levant, this book demonstrates how members of marginalized (disempowered) groups sculpt a positive image for themselves, engage in solidarity formation for group empowerment and (re)construct their experiences in a manner that gives them voice, agency and positive identity.
